Output 263f3f874281e23d07d4dfbefb8e00a227d64b9f7603e335211a82c08f741db5:0

value
89660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770f38d8d8df76c2715cabf61191af1ead563322 OP_EQUAL
address
3CYYa23NVFqL1FE5oYZEzZusLTFKYphtpL
transaction
263f3f874281e23d07d4dfbefb8e00a227d64b9f7603e335211a82c08f741db5
spent
true